The Rise of Fast Charging
Fast charging isn’t a gimmick—it’s a game changer. Charging technologies like USB Power Delivery, Qualcomm’s Quick Charge, and other proprietary systems are redefining our relationship with our devices. By 2025, many smartphones, tablets, and even laptops can fully charge in under an hour. For hardcore gamers glued to their screens or casual gamers fitting in a quick session between errands, this technology is nothing short of revolutionary.
Did you know that a modern smartphone can achieve about 50% charge in just 15 minutes? This is more than just a statistical bragging point; it’s a crucial development for the daily user.
